Output 84120a1e453ece840a14c7bda233c95ee74ef89502a83ab613f38e8f9f489a89:1

value
24913779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e754d7881b60bca31d6ae61d22df9dfcc97849a4 OP_EQUAL
address
MUzKxfQbDMwN5WLFxLQaVu2LS4eTgyXCns
transaction
84120a1e453ece840a14c7bda233c95ee74ef89502a83ab613f38e8f9f489a89
spent
true